You will be updated with latest job alerts via emailThe LCRA Transmission Operational Intelligence team is providing an outstanding opportunity for an ambitious Software Developer to join our Operational Technology Solutions team in Austin TX. At LCRA we believe in fostering a collaborative and inclusive environment where your talents can truly shine. If you are looking to contribute at the highest level developing impactful and innovative solutions this role is for you!
You will be trusted to:
- Gather and document user requirements and functional/technical specifications for software solutions to improve processes and ensure efficient system designs.
- Program code and develop moderately complex software applications.
- Rewrite or rework existing software programs based on new requirements.
- Maintain existing software programs. Troubleshoots and provide tier 3 user support for software applications.
- Coordinate software development activities with operational technology staff.
- Provide system training to end users/system owners.
You qualify with:
- Six or more years of experience in developing and programming/coding software applications or relevant experience. A degree(s) in computer science or relevant field may be substituted per LCRA guidelines for certain years of experience.
